Qualcomm hangs on to most Apple gains after earnings report
Qualcomm Inc shares fell about 3.5% on Wednesday as investors got their first look at the bottom line impact of a patent fight settlement with Apple Inc, including a multibillion dollar one-time payment and more modest future patent fees.
